Prohibition on Employees Earning Less than 2.6 Million Pounds

The Minister of Labor in the caretaker government, Mustafa Bayram, pointed out that "the Index Committee is monitoring the situation, and its successive meetings conclude with results, and practically, it has become prohibited in the private sector for any employee to earn less than 2.6 million pounds." Bayram added in an interview with "Radio Al Nour" that "the Index Committee is the legal entry point for the proposal related to salary increases and transportation allowances, which will be submitted to the Prime Minister and will inform the President of the Republic, leading to the issuance of an exceptional decree to approve the increases."
